.FeedbackModal-module__IE1dHa__modalOverlay{z-index:1000;background-color:rgba(0,0,0,.7);justify-content:center;align-items:center;display:flex;position:fixed;top:0;bottom:0;left:0;right:0}.FeedbackModal-module__IE1dHa__modal{color:#000;background:#fff;border-radius:8px;flex-direction:column;width:80%;max-width:80%;height:80%;max-height:80%;padding:20px;display:flex;position:relative;overflow-y:auto}.FeedbackModal-module__IE1dHa__closeButton{cursor:pointer;background:0 0;border:none;font-size:24px;position:absolute;top:10px;right:10px}.FeedbackModal-module__IE1dHa__formGroup{margin-bottom:15px}.FeedbackModal-module__IE1dHa__formGroup label{margin-bottom:5px;font-weight:700;display:block}.FeedbackModal-module__IE1dHa__formGroup input,.FeedbackModal-module__IE1dHa__formGroup textarea,.FeedbackModal-module__IE1dHa__formGroup select{box-sizing:border-box;border:1px solid #ccc;border-radius:4px;width:100%;padding:8px}.FeedbackModal-module__IE1dHa__submitButton{color:#fff;cursor:pointer;background-color:#007bff;border:none;border-radius:4px;align-self:flex-start;width:25%;padding:10px 20px;transition:background-color .3s}.FeedbackModal-module__IE1dHa__submitButton:hover{background-color:#0056b3}.FeedbackModal-module__IE1dHa__successMessage{color:green;margin-top:20px;font-weight:700}
.SearchComponent-module__m4ua9G__searchContainer{align-items:center;gap:10px;display:flex}.SearchComponent-module__m4ua9G__searchInput{box-sizing:border-box;border:1px solid #ddd;border-radius:25px;width:100%;padding:12px 20px;font-size:18px;transition:border-color .3s,box-shadow .3s}.SearchComponent-module__m4ua9G__searchInput:focus{border-color:#007bff;outline:none;box-shadow:0 0 8px rgba(0,123,255,.3)}.SearchComponent-module__m4ua9G__searchButton{color:#fff;cursor:pointer;background-color:#007bff;border:none;border-radius:50%;padding:10px;font-size:18px;transition:background-color .3s}.SearchComponent-module__m4ua9G__searchButton:hover{background-color:#0056b3}.SearchComponent-module__m4ua9G__searchResults{margin-top:20px;padding:0;list-style:none}.SearchComponent-module__m4ua9G__searchResultItem{border-bottom:1px solid #eee;align-items:center;padding:10px 0;transition:background-color .2s;display:flex}.SearchComponent-module__m4ua9G__searchResultItem:hover{background-color:#f9f9f9}.SearchComponent-module__m4ua9G__resultItemContent{align-items:center;display:flex}.SearchComponent-module__m4ua9G__resultImage{object-fit:cover;border-radius:8px;width:60px;height:60px;margin-right:15px}.SearchComponent-module__m4ua9G__noImage{color:#888;background-color:#f0f0f0;border-radius:8px;justify-content:center;align-items:center;width:60px;height:60px;margin-right:15px;display:flex}.SearchComponent-module__m4ua9G__resultText{color:#333;font-weight:700;text-decoration:none}.SearchComponent-module__m4ua9G__resultText a{color:inherit;text-decoration:none}
.ModalSearch-module__Y6BHFq__modalOverlay{z-index:1000;background-color:rgba(0,0,0,.7);justify-content:center;align-items:center;display:flex;position:fixed;top:0;bottom:0;left:0;right:0}.ModalSearch-module__Y6BHFq__modal{background:#fff;border-radius:12px;width:60%;max-width:700px;padding:20px;transition:transform .3s ease-out,opacity .3s ease-out;position:relative;box-shadow:0 8px 16px rgba(0,0,0,.2)}.ModalSearch-module__Y6BHFq__modalOverlay .ModalSearch-module__Y6BHFq__modal{opacity:0;animation:.3s forwards ModalSearch-module__Y6BHFq__modalOpen;transform:translateY(-20px)}@keyframes ModalSearch-module__Y6BHFq__modalOpen{to{opacity:1;transform:translateY(0)}}.ModalSearch-module__Y6BHFq__modalHeader{justify-content:space-between;align-items:center;margin-bottom:20px;display:flex}.ModalSearch-module__Y6BHFq__modalHeader h2{color:#333;margin:0;font-size:24px}.ModalSearch-module__Y6BHFq__closeButton{cursor:pointer;color:#3a2c5a;background:0 0;border:none;border-radius:10%;justify-content:center;align-items:center;padding:10px;font-size:24px;transition:color .3s;display:flex}.ModalSearch-module__Y6BHFq__closeButton:hover{color:#5a6888;background-color:#f0f0f0}.ModalSearch-module__Y6BHFq__modalContent{max-height:400px;overflow-y:auto}
.Search-module__pL7k9a__open-search-button{color:#fff;cursor:pointer;background-color:#007bff;border:none;border-radius:50px;padding:10px 20px;font-size:16px;transition:background-color .3s;box-shadow:0 4px 6px rgba(0,123,255,.3)}.Search-module__pL7k9a__open-search-button:hover{background-color:#0056b3;box-shadow:0 6px 8px rgba(0,86,179,.4)}
